DISPLAY
CODE
F136
Food probe configuration alarm:
If food probe is configured and not detected after start-up an
alarm is set. The alarm has no impact on the loads. Food
probe temperature is not valid (not updated)! This alarm can
only be reset with restart.
F236
Alarm due to the software bug :
This alarm occurs due to the bug in the software. Which is
fixed in the software update
F137
Food probe communication alarm:
Food probe module was detected and the oven is on but
communication is lost for more than 15sec. an alarm is set.
This alarm is reset automatically if the communication is
there again or if the oven is switched off. The alarm has no
impact on the loads.
Only food probe temperature is old or zero (short circuit).
F138
Fix sensor detection alarm:
For safety reasons it is necessary to check the oven sensor
that it's working. If the oven sensor does not change, if the
oven is on, alarm is sent and the PWM signal is switched off.
This alarm is reset automatically after 4 minute if the oven is
off (switching on/off is refreshing the 4min).
F239
Quantum Touch Controller alarm:
1. If the communication over the bus SPI with the
Quantum touch is after 50 trials unsuccessful than
alarm is set. The alarm is reset if the communication
is okay again.
2. If an incorrect ELC is used for a configuration of the
naked electronics or a configured spare part :
This error occurs due to different electronic software
between User Interface and touch electronics
F241
Function selector not connected alarm OUI Hexagon:
If the function selector is not connected for a time longer than
10 sec. the failure will be displayed and system off command
will be sent to power board. The failure will be detected if +5V
is on the micro input for function selector.
Failure indication is independent of oven state. This means
the failure code F241 will be displayed as long as failure is
active. After the re-establishment of the connection the OUI
displays "---°C" timeout if function selector is not in zero
position else ToD. If timeout symbol is in display user has to
switch first to zero position before selection of an OVF.
